What is WPA Form 4 – Abbreviated Notice of Intent?
WPA Form 4 – Abbreviated Notice of Intent is a document that notifies regulatory authorities of an intention to conduct activities that may impact wetland resources, ensuring compliance with environmental regulations.
Who is required to file WPA Form 4 – Abbreviated Notice of Intent?
Anyone planning to conduct activities that could potentially alter wetlands or waterways, such as construction, landscaping, or land development, is typically required to file WPA Form 4.
How to fill out WPA Form 4 – Abbreviated Notice of Intent?
To fill out WPA Form 4, applicants must provide details about the proposed project, including the project description, project location, and any potential impacts on the wetland environment, and submit it to the appropriate regulatory agency.
What is the purpose of WPA Form 4 – Abbreviated Notice of Intent?
The purpose of WPA Form 4 is to inform environmental regulators of planned activities that may affect wetlands, allowing them to assess potential impacts and ensure compliance with environmental protection laws.
What information must be reported on WPA Form 4 – Abbreviated Notice of Intent?
Important information to be reported includes the project location, a description of the proposed activities, the anticipated start and completion dates, and any measures to mitigate environmental impacts.
